【摘要】:煤粉產(chǎn)出是影響煤層氣井連續(xù)、穩(wěn)定排采的重要因素之一。歸納總結(jié)了煤粉濃度監(jiān)測(cè)的4種方法:無標(biāo)樣的目視法、有標(biāo)樣的色度對(duì)比法、稱量法和煤粉濃度監(jiān)測(cè)儀監(jiān)測(cè)法;分析了臨汾區(qū)塊影響煤粉產(chǎn)出的煤儲(chǔ)層靜態(tài)地質(zhì)因素和煤層氣開發(fā)動(dòng)態(tài)工程因素;基于臨汾區(qū)塊煤層氣井產(chǎn)出煤粉濃度的現(xiàn)場(chǎng)連續(xù)監(jiān)測(cè)數(shù)據(jù),利用測(cè)井解釋與回歸分析等方法,建立了煤粉濃度與構(gòu)造煤厚度、套壓的相關(guān)關(guān)系。
[Abstract]:Pulverized coal production is one of the important factors affecting the continuous and stable drainage of coalbed methane wells.Four methods of pulverized coal concentration monitoring are summarized: visual method without standard sample, colorimetric contrast method with standard sample, weighing method and monitoring method of pulverized coal concentration monitor.The static geological factors of coal reservoir and the dynamic engineering factors of coalbed methane development in Linfen block are analyzed, and the methods of log interpretation and regression analysis are used based on the field continuous monitoring data of coal powder concentration produced from coalbed methane wells in Linfen block.The correlation between pulverized coal concentration and tectonic coal thickness and casing pressure was established.
